Definitions

American Heritage® Dictionary of the English Language, Fourth Edition

  1. n. A tarmacadam road or surface, especially an airport runway.
  2. v. To cause (an aircraft) to sit on a taxiway.
  3. v. To sit on a taxiway. Used of an aircraft.

Wiktionary

  1. n. UK, Canada The bituminous surface of a road.
  2. n. aviation Area of an airport where planes park or maneuver.
  3. v. UK, Canada To pave
  4. v. aviation To spend time idling on a runway, usually waiting for takeoff clearance

Etymologies

  1. Shortening of tarmacadam, which is tar + macadam (crushed stones). (Wiktionary)
  2. Originally a trademark. (American Heritage® Dictionary of the English Language, Fourth Edition)
